It was a proper cat-fight when Manzanola duked it out with Holly on Friday. The Bobcats were beaten by the Wildcats 75-23. The Bobcats have struggled against the Wildcats recently, as the game was their third consecutive lost matchup.
Manzanola used a three-pronged attack on offense: Julian Chavez, Mark Holland, and Ethan Rocha posted six points each.
Holly got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Alex Vazquez out in front who went 8-for-12 from beyond the arc to rack up 26 points. Noel Lopez was another key player, shooting 63% from the field en route to 10 points in addition to six assists and five steals.
Manzanola's defeat dropped their record down to 1-3. As for Holly, the win got them back to even at 2-2.
Manzanola has already played their next matchup, a 74-34 loss against Granada on the 13th. As for Holly, they will take on McClave in a tournament on Thursday.
